Version 1.3.41 (in progress)
============================
2010-01-10: wsfulton
Fix a few inconsistencies in reporting of file/line numberings including modifying
the overload warnings 509, 512, 516 to now be two line warnings.
2010-01-10: wsfulton
Modify -debug-tags output to use standard file name/line reporting so that editors
can easily navigate to the appropriate lines.
